Size

The right bunk or loft bed for kids frees the floor space for playtime while creating a wow factor in their bedroom. Choose a low-profile bunk bed that's just 2 inches above the floor to accommodate smaller spaces. If you want more space, go for a twin over full bunk bed or twin loft beds that come with a built-in shelves and desk. You can also get a stacked bunk bed that can sleep three kids at a time (just ensure you have enough clearance from the ceiling to accommodate the triple option).

Bunk beds are very popular, especially for kids who share a bedroom or have limited space. Think about your child's growth and height prior to buying a loft or bunk bed for kids. You should also be aware of their ability to safely climb up or down the top bunk. You can observe how they play on outdoor playground equipment to assess their climbing abilities and whether they're ready for a more elevated sleeping spot.

Safety

Many people opt for bunk beds for their children as they're space savers, but they can also be a big risk to safety for children who aren't old enough to be sleeping on the top bunk. kids bunk beds can fall off the side of the bed or be caught in the gap between the ladder and the mattress below. To make sure your kids are sleeping in a safe manner, look for bunk beds that are compliant with national safety standards and has been certified by an independent test lab.

Check that the bed is equipped with guard rails all around with gaps of no greater than 3.5 inches to avoid strangulation. Make sure the mattress foundation isn't too deep and solid. A mattress that is too deep could cause the guardrails' to collapse. Avoid bunk beds that have ladders that extend beyond the frame. These types of ladders are more likely to get caught in curtains or other objects. Children should not climb on or play on the bunk bed or side. They should not play with toys or other items on or near the ladder. The best location for a bunkbed is in the corner of the room, so that the beds are joined on both sides by the walls. It is important to keep bunk beds away from ceiling fans and hanging lights, as they can be dangerous for those who bump their heads on them when seated upright in bed.

Stairs or ladders should be securely attached to the bunk bed and come with anti-entrapment features to prevent accidents when climbing up and down. It's important to have a firm area for children to climb and fall down, such as a carpet or a stair runner.

It's important to teach children the rules to follow when bunk beds, for example, not jumping on or playing with them and only sleeping on them. Also, instruct that they should use the ladder only for going up and down, not as a step stool or a climbing frame. Kids should also be taught not to hang objects like belts, scarves jump ropes or other ornaments from bunk beds since they can cause strangulation.
